Question 32413: the chinese used a way of measuring heighth of a mountin by viewing it from 2 diffrent locations and counculating the angle from where thay were to the top of the mountain. the frist angle measure was 8.7° and the 2nd was 7.5°. the two angles were measured from 18,325 feet apart. how tall is the mountain?

Answer by rfadrogane(214)   (Show Source): You can put this solution on YOUR website!
h(cot 7.5 deg - cot 8.7 deg) = 18,325
h = 18,325/(cot 7.5 deg - cot 8.7 deg.)
h = 17,275.92 ft.---ans..
